将此类日期格式[Tue Mar 04 2014 00:00:00 GMT + 0530(斯里兰卡标准时间)]转换为Java日期对象

时间:2014-03-05 13:23:52

标签: java javascript date fullcalendar

我正在使用Jquery FullCalendar并且它有一个方法可以在日期单元格事件单击时调用。

dayClick: function(date, allDay, jsEvent, view) 
{
    if (allDay)
    {
        alert('Clicked on the entire day: ' + date);
    }else
    {
        alert('Clicked on the slot: ' + date);
    }
}

有点像上面那样。但它打印的日期或它在date中的日期是这样的。 Tue Mar 04 2014 00:00:00 GMT+0530 (Sri Lanka Standard Time)

如何将这种格式化的字符串转换为Java Date对象。 当我解析它时,它将通过parseException。 我需要获得格式为yyyy-MM-dd

的Java Date对象

已更新: 基本上我需要转换格式的日期字符串 Tue Mar 04 2014 00:00:00 GMT+0530 (Sri Lanka Standard Time) 到Java Date对象。 (特别是格式为yyyy-MM-dd

1 个答案:

答案 0 :(得分:0)

基本上我想更改FullCalendar date对象的格式。 我通过以下方式实现了这一目标。

默认情况下,date具有以下格式。 Tue Mar 04 2014 00:00:00 GMT+0530 (Sri Lanka Standard Time)

var dd = $.fullCalendar.formatDate(date,"yyyy-MM-dd");